DayZ Standalone released on Steam early access

QUOTE
DayZ's standalone version, the follow-up to the popular Arma 2 mod, is out now on Steam early access for $30. Unfortunately, DayZ creator Dean Hall was notified at the last minute that the launch trailer (below) that Steam pulled his trailer "due to censorship," but you can still watch it thanks to YouTube.

The trailer may have been pulled because of the suicide you see in the end, which we know is a new feature in the game.

As we've previously reported, Hall has made it explicitly clear that this is an alpha build of the game in the truest sense of the term. It is a work in progress, only a representation of what's to come, and filthy with bugs only players who want to observe and participate in the development process should buy into.

True to his word, Hall gave this warning top billing over any other cool features in DayZ. The main description of the game on Steam reads:

"WARNING: THIS GAME IS EARLY ACCESS ALPHA. PLEASE DO NOT PURCHASE IT UNLESS YOU WANT TO ACTIVELY SUPPORT DEVELOPMENT OF THE GAME AND ARE PREPARED TO HANDLE WITH SERIOUS ISSUES AND POSSIBLE INTERRUPTIONS OF GAME FUNCTIONING."

And only then does he describe the experience, a realistic, open-world survival horror hybrid-MMO.

Disclaimers aside, the descriptions of what's included in the alpha currently available on Steam is sure to get a lot of people to buy into it. It already has Chernarus, the 230km² landmass of deep forests, cities, and villages that severs as DayZ's playground, and it can already handle up to 40 players per server. Persistent player profiles, crafting and other staples of the original DayZ mode are also all in there to varying degrees. We'll see you there, but we won't trust you to not steal our stuff.

DayZ standalone gets new screenshots and progress report: “everything has been redone”

user posted image

user posted image

user posted image

user posted image

user posted image

user posted image

user posted image

user posted image

QUOTE
Development on the standalone version of the DayZ mod has snowballed into more intense territory than anticipated. DayZ creator Dean Hall has posted an update on the DayZ blog to say that “The experience will be entirely new. There is virtually nothing that has been directly ported from the mod, everything has been redone. This wasn’t our original intention (hence the December deadline) – but it has evolved this way. We’re all glad it has!” Read on to find out what the team’s been tinkering with.

Hall says that character development is “the absolute core of our current design efforts.” New models for ethnic female characters have been added, and there’s more to come. “Until initial release, the vast majority of our efforts will be with expanding options for developing and customizing your character.”

Meanwhile, DayZ’s lead programmer is shifting the multiplayer engine to a “server-client MMO mode,” which will add a bit of much-needed stability. If you want to run games for your community, good news: “Private servers will be supported.”

Designer Ivan Buchta has also rejoined the team after the Greece ordeal, and is working on renovating the DayZ’s island. You can see the results in the latest DayZ screenshots below, spotted by Kotaku

DayZ Standalone’s latest development update shows the finest in zombie acting

QUOTE
The latest DayZ Standalone update dispenses with the technical round-ups of recent posts, and instead focuses on creator Dean “Rocket” Hall having violent and unnatural spasms. Because he’s doing motion capture work for the game. Not because he’s possessed or anything. Probably.

The twenty minute video takes you through the mo-capping process, and features select interviews with DayZ’s animation team. In it, you can learn Bohemia animator Martin Michalik’s favourite mo-capped animation for DayZ. Spoiler: it’s “defecation”. Wait, what?

Don’t expect a huge splurge of information about the status of the project. Still, it’s an interesting look at a particular aspect of development and, at the very least, is good for a cheap laugh or two.
